- Description The 50th Contracting Squadron, Schriever AFB intends to solicit proposals for Mobile Storage Equipment and installation to Diego Garcia AS, to support new office design and organization. The NAICS code for this acquisition is 337215 and the size standard is 500 Employees. This Firm-Fixed Price Requirements contract will be issued for small business participation and must be BRAND NAME specific. SPACESAVER INC. has been chosen for the storage system MANUFACTURER, which will exactly match office conformity and mounting specifications. In accordance with government small business goals, all categories of small businesses are encouraged to participate. Please see solicitation FA2550-07-T-2007 and the Amendment attachment, which will be posted on this site approximately 1 business day after this notice. This synopsis summarizes the needed Mobile Storage Equipment for 22 SOPS Diego Garcia AS, which will include all items outlined by the posted solicitation and other attachments deemed fit. OMBUDSMAN (AUG 2005) (a) An ombudsman has been appointed to hear and facilitate the resolution of concerns from offerors, potential offerors, and others for this acquisition. When requested, the ombudsman will maintain strict confidentiality as to the source of the concern. The existence of the ombudsman does not affect the authority of the program manager, contracting officer, or source selection official. Further, the ombudsman does not participate in the evaluation of proposals, the source selection process, or the adjudication of protests or formal contract disputes. The ombudsman may refer the party to another official who can resolve the concern. (b) Before consulting with an ombudsman, interested parties must first address their concerns, issues, disagreements, and/or recommendations to the contracting officer for resolution. Consulting an ombudsman does not alter or postpone the timelines for any other processes (e.g., agency level bid protests, GAO bid protests, requests for debriefings, employee-employer actions, contests of OMB Circular A-76 competition performance decisions). (c) If resolution cannot be made by the contracting officer, concerned parties may contact the Center/MAJCOM ombudsmen, Diane S. Holmes, HQ AFSPC/A7K, (719) 692-5324, diane.holmes@afspc.af.mil. Concerns, issues, disagreements, and recommendations that cannot be resolved at the MAJCOM/DRU level, may be brought by the concerned party for further consideration to the Air Force ombudsman, Associate Deputy Assistant Secretary (ADAS) (Contracting), SAF/AQC, 1060 Air Force Pentagon, Washington DC 20330-1060, phone number (703) 588-7004, facsimile number (703) 588-1067. (d) The ombudsman has no authority to render a decision that binds the agency. (e) Do not contact the ombudsman to request copies of the solicitation, verify offer due date, or clarify technical requirements. Such inquiries shall be directed to the Contracting Officer.
